'09 World Championship
'09 Fall Super Stakes Championship
'09 Youth World Championship


Due to the ice storm that devastated the hunting in many areas of Western Kentucky, and after much discussion, debate, and consideration, the decision has been made to change the site of the 2009 PKC Fall Super Stakes Championship, Youth World Championship, and World Championship to Salem, Illinois.

Many of our members will agree with this change, while many others will not. I assure you that we have made this decision based exclusively on the best interest of PKC and its’ membership. The ice storm that hit Western Kentucky this past winter destroyed quite a bit of timber, and has made it extremely difficult to hunt much of the area. It is our feeling that continuing to remain in this area would cause extremely low attendance; the downed timber may cause unnecessary injury to handlers and dogs; among many other negatives.

To the clubs and hunters in Western Kentucky, as well as, the support groups that been a vital part of the successes of these events in the past, we say a heartfelt “THANK YOU”. Hopefully, all will understand the necessity for this move.

We will hold the 2009 Breeders’ Showcase in Aurora in July, and feel that we have made the necessary adjustments to allow those participating to hunt in the least damaged areas of Western Kentucky. We can’t promise anything, but feel that our efforts will benefit our members attending the Breeders’ Showcase, as we have added some Tennessee clubs that were not devastated by the ice storm.

We have met with each group in the Salem, IL area regarding their role in hosting the PKC World Championships. Each group from the Salem Economic Development Commission, the Marion County Fair Board, the Illinois Conservation Department, and the Satellite Club Network have assured us that they will work tirelessly to make sure this event is successful. This will be a different setup to those accustomed to attending the World Hunt in Aurora; there will be some adjustments to be made. Renovations will have to be made to the facility at the fairgrounds, and we have been assured that those changes will be made before the beginning of the events.

We will try and keep everyone abreast of any changes that would affect our members in the months and weeks to come. We ask for everyone’s support and understanding during this transition period, and expect to provide the same quality events in Salem, Illinois in October that our members have grown accustomed to in Aurora.
